Hi guys. After 6 years of doing life things, I've picked up another VX. Not in the best state so the aim is to get it roadworthy again. It has done 90k miles but the engine is on around 45k (has had it swapped out).

 

Its previous owner had it for around 3 years but the last 1 it was sat laid up. Has a few bits that come with it:

Calypso Red with Black details (lights and petrol cap etc)

Hard Top

Tubby Spoiler

2 sets of wheels

2 diffusers (no idea what they are)

SPAX RSX suspension

Supercharger conversion half complete

TMS exhaust manifold

VSE

 

Plus the old engine and gearbox as spare

Been doing a bit of work on it:

  • Gave the chassis/various suspension bits a coat of metal paint to hold off the rust and make it look a little nicer.
  • Replaced the tensioner and belt with a 1285 (from a 1270 which was goddamn tight).
  • Ran the hoses for the charge cooling down the sills
  • Connected up all of the CC hoses to the manifold and tank (it's a funny little one on this car)
  • Re-wired the 'yellow relay' to take a normal relay (just don't press the button when the engine is running)
  • Replaced the other two boot relays
  • Wired in the relay & fuse for the charge cooler pump
  • Dremel'd off the 3 annoying bolts that connect the rad surround to the crash box (the ones nearest the windscreen)
  • Started replacing the discs and pads
  • Stuck the front SPAX on (no idea why it was running on front bilstein OEM and rear SPAX)
  • Put the exhaust back on in preparation to start it up soon.
